We have four different stories of Jesus’ life contained in these four books to offer different, holy & sacred perspectives of that same story. We and yet we each need Jesus and strive to follow him. Throughout this series we will be encountering these stories in these four gospels by thinking through who this particular book was written to reach; what we might learn; and how we might be transformed into action by becoming more Jesus-like in our lives.


John’s gospel is over here vibing, taking turns and stops we hadn’t experienced in the other gospels. And John brings in the imagination, the mysticism, or that is to say where the veil is thin, where we encounter the divine, go beyond what makes sense, we enter into territory where we need a story to imagine it, to grasp it. the storytelling that is so crucial to survival and hope.
